New to this edition
More than 260 new chapters keep you at the leading edge of veterinary therapy.
Key Features
Authoritative, reliable information on diagnosis includes details on the latest therapies.
An organ-system organization makes it easy to find solutions for specific disorders.
Concise chapters are only 2-5 pages in length, saving you time in finding essential information.
Well-known writers and editors provide accurate, up-to-date coverage of important topics.
A convenient Table of Common Drugs, updated by Dr. Mark Papich, offers a quick reference to dosage information.
Cross-references to the previous edition make it easy to find related information that remains valid and current.
A list of references and suggested readings is included at the end of most chapters.
A fully searchable companion Evolve website adds chapters from Kirk’s Current Veterinary Therapy XIII, with information that has not changed significantly since its publication. It also includes an image collection with over 300 images, and references linked to PubMed. Useful appendices on the website provide a virtual library of valuable clinical references on laboratory test procedures and interpretation, normal reference ranges, body fluid analyses, conversion tables, nutritional profiles, a drug formulary, and more.
